Environmental Health Department requires a soil suitability/nitrate loading study <br /> incorporating proposed staff and customer use, indicating that the area is suitable for septic <br /> tank usage. This must be performed prior to issuance of building permits (San Joaquin <br /> County Development Title, Section 9-1105.2(d)). A nitrate loading study is required, and a <br /> review fee of$445.00 must be paid at time of submittal to Environmental Health <br /> Department. <br /> The sewage disposal system shall comply with the on site sewage standards of San Joaquin <br /> County prior to approval. A percolation test that meets absorption rates of the manual of <br /> septic tank practice or E.P.A. Design Manual for onsite wastewater treatment and disposal <br /> system is required for each parcel. A permit fee of$89.00 per percolation hole is required. <br /> NOTE: In accordance with the conditional zoning of this parcel,the study shall document the <br /> waste stream(s)of this proposed industrial use. <br /> B. State on revised site plans the maximum number of proposed staff and customer use the <br /> sewage disposal system is being designed for. In addition, show on revised plans that the <br /> leach field area will be barricaded so it cannot be driven over,parked on, or used as a storage <br /> area. This leach field area must be used for that specific purpose only, and it cannot contain <br /> any underground utility lines (San Joaquin County Development Title, Section 9- <br /> 1110.4(c)(5)). The revised plans shall demonstrate the required 100%designed sewage <br /> replacement area as required by the regulations. t/ <br /> Page I oft 5-13- <br />
